Research progress on the mechanisms of acupuncture in improving ischemic stroke through autophagy
Yu Wang1, Yi-Ning Dai1, Xiao-Jing Guo1
1Heilongjiang University of Chinese Medicine, Harbin 150040, China.
Abstract:
Stroke is a major disease with high incidence, disability rate, and mortality worldwide. In recent years, a large number of studies have comfirmed that acupuncture treatment for ischemic stroke is closely related to the regulation of autophagy mechanisms. This article summarizes the literature in recent years, discusses the effects of acupuncture on the degradation pathways mediated by autophagosomes, the expression of autophagy-related proteins, autophagy-related pathways, and the impact of mitophagy, and further explores the mechanisms of acupuncture in regulating autophagy to improve ischemic stroke, providing new ideas and schemes for clinical treatment.
